The self-titled debut album, recorded in just 30 hours, laid the blueprint for heavy rock. Combining heavy blues covers with original compositions, it shocked the music industry. Key tracks like "Dazed and Confused" and "Good Times Bad Times" showcase a raw, high-energy performance that sounds spectacularly spacious in high-resolution lossless audio.
